    Lightbulb Are you browsing the forums on a Mac via Mozilla Firefox or Google Chrome?

    Now I know there has been extensive reviews out there already about these two browsers - gotta love the browser wars huh

    So I am just wondering what is your pick? Personally, I have been a long Firefox user, since 04 and though I played around with Safari and Opera, they were nothing more then "one surf stands". And though I have heard of Chrome long before and had to wait for a long time before it is was matured enough to be given serious consideration which I believe is about now, I am beginning to like the experience that Chrome gives me.

    A browser really does change your entire online experience especially if you are a power user, and as much as it has to be capable it doesn't hurt if it it was nicely designed.

    Take a look at how each renders the drop down menu on the forum:
    * Safari is just there for comparison sake

    FIREFOX


    SAFARI


    CHROME


    Notice how Chrome mimics the native UI unlike Firefox. Subtle differences which may not influence your experience but just a comparison.

    I have found equivalent extensions to my Firefox on Chrome and although they are not as customizable or as sophisticated, they do look and function smoother, and most of all I don't have to restart every time I add a new one.

    So am guessing I might dump firefox for chrome, I have already made it default browser but am not planning to thrash it completely - who knows what might happen in the future.

    I was in about the same place you are, a longtime Firefox fan, developing an interest in Chrome. Just as my use of Chrome was surpassing Firefox, a Chrome update came out that broke it on my computer (it still ran but settings/extensions were reset every time it started, it would freeze up if left on too long. It took them months to figure out why it was happening for only a small fraction of users, and though it is now fixed, I am not giving Chrome another shot until I see some reason to.

    Quote Originally Posted by flaimdude View Post
    Safari, duh.
    Sorry Flaim, but Safari is the generic peanut butter and jelly sandwich of browsers, and will never seriously compete with FF or Chrome IMO. And they would have to flat out beat Chrome too, since they are both webkit-based and present almost identical browsing experiences (but Chrome with many more frills). I suppose if Google really blows it with Chrome somehow, then maybe...
